One Injured in Austin Three-Vehicle Crash at North Lamar Blvd and West Koenig Lane

Austin, Texas (March 25, 2022) – One person was injured Thursday afternoon in a rollover crash in north-central Austin, according to the authorities.

The crash was reported around 12:01 p.m., March 24, at the intersection of North Lamar Blvd and West Koenig Lane.

Authorities said three vehicles were involved in the crash. One of the vehicles rolled over, trapping the driver. The victim was extricated and taken to Dell Seton Medical Center with minor injuries.

Two other people refused transportation to the hospital.

Multiple lanes were closed while first responders worked the scene. The scene was cleared just before 1:00 p.m.

No other information was available.

The crash remains under investigation.

Common Causes of Automobile Accidents

There are many different reasons why automobile, 18-wheeler, and motorcycle accidents occur, including driver negligence, driver inattention, texting and driving, speeding, fatigue, failure to yield the right of way from a stop sign or private drive, running a red light, and driving under the influence of alcohol or drugs.
